International Parkside Products Inc (IPD) has a Tangible Net Worth Ratio of 75.3% as of January 2026. This metric is calculated by deducting intangible assets (CA$41.03K) from net assets (CA$165.88K) and expressing it as a percentage of total net assets. A higher ratio means that more of the company's equity is backed by tangible, balance-sheet-verifiable assets rather than goodwill, patents, or brand value.
